Samsung Galaxy M05

The Samsung Galaxy M05 is a budget-friendly smartphone packed with essential features for the everyday user. With a good balance of performance, battery life, and storage, it provides a solid experience at a reasonable price. Let's break down the review into key sections.

1. Design and Display
  • Design:

    • Lightweight plastic build with a glossy finish.

    • Curved edges for comfortable grip.

    • Available in multiple color variants.

  • Display:

    • 6.5-inch HD+ Infinity-V display with a 1600 x 720 pixel resolution.

    • Ideal for casual media consumption with decent color and sharpness.

  • Refresh Rate:

    • Standard 60Hz refresh rate.

    • Smooth enough for regular browsing and apps.

2. Performance and Software
  • Processor:

    • Powered by the MediaTek Helio P35 octa-core processor.

    • 4x Cortex-A53 at 2.3GHz and 4x Cortex-A53 at 1.8GHz for basic multitasking.

    • Handles day-to-day tasks like browsing, social media, and light gaming.

  • RAM and Storage:

    • Comes with 4GB RAM and 64GB internal storage.

    • Expandable storage up to 1TB with a microSD card.

  • Software:

    • Runs One UI Core 4.1 based on Android 12.

    • Clean and user-friendly interface optimized for budget hardware.

3. Camera Performance
  • Primary Camera:

    • 50MP main rear camera with f/1.8 aperture for detailed shots in good lighting.

    • Delivers natural color reproduction and decent dynamic range.

  • Secondary Camera:

    • 2MP depth sensor for portrait shots.

    • Creates a good bokeh effect but can struggle in complex backgrounds.

  • Front Camera:

    • 5MP front camera with f/2.2 aperture.

    • Adequate for selfies and video calls, though not suited for low-light conditions.

  • Video Recording:

    • Supports 1080p video recording at 30fps.

    • Standard video quality for budget devices.

4. Battery Life and Charging
  • Battery Capacity:

    • Large 5000mAh battery for extended use.

    • Easily lasts more than a day with moderate usage.

  • Charging:

    • Supports 15W fast charging.

    • Charges relatively quickly given the battery size.

  • USB Type-C:

    • USB Type-C port for faster charging and data transfer.

    • More reliable compared to micro-USB, common in budget phones.

5. Connectivity and Additional Features
  • Connectivity:

    • Supports 4G LTE, Wi-Fi 802.11 b/g/n, Bluetooth 5.0, and GPS.

    • Dual SIM capability for users needing multiple SIM cards.

  • Fingerprint Sensor:

    • Side-mounted fingerprint sensor for quick and convenient unlocking.

    • Responsive and easy to access.

  • Other Features:

    • Includes a 3.5mm headphone jack for wired audio.

    • Dedicated microSD card slot for expanding storage without sacrificing SIM slots.
